Overview

2S-13 is an experimental synthetic compound belonging to the 2S-series of pyridazine derivatives, specifically described as ethyl (E)-2-(2-(4-carbamoylphenyl)-6-(4-chlorobenzoyl)pyridazine-3(2H)-ylidene)acetate. It has demonstrated strong anticancer effects in preclinical studies, especially in the human triple-negative breast cancer (TNBC) cell line MDA-MB-231. The compound was synthesized as part of a series of novel pyridazine derivatives evaluated for their cytotoxicity and potential as anticancer agents. The exact mechanism of action has not been fully elucidated, but its anticancer effect has been established in vitro[2].
